AI Product Video Ads: Turn Product Photos into Scroll-Stopping Video
A single product photo isn't enough for a feed ad anymore — testing what actually stops a scroll means producing several video variants, not one hero clip. Image-to-video models turn a product photo into a batch of short ad candidates, but ads have two requirements a general photo-to-video workflow doesn't: a hook in the first few seconds, and a product that looks identical across every variant.

Two Things Ads Need That a Single Clip Doesn't
A hook in the first few seconds. A feed scroller decides to keep watching almost instantly, so the opening motion — a fast unveil, a light sweep across the label, a quick rotation — matters more than anything that happens later in the clip.
Identical product identity across every variant. Testing five hook ideas only works if the product itself doesn't drift between them — same color, same label text, same shape in every version. A variant where the label blurs or the product's proportions shift isn't a usable test candidate; it's noise in the results.
Choosing a Model for Ad Production
Which model to reach for depends on where you are in the ad-testing cycle, not which one has the highest spec sheet:
- Batch-testing several hook ideas — LTX 2.3 (720p/1080p, 6–20 second clips) or Seedance 2.0 Fast (480p/720p) both prioritize turnaround speed and lower cost, which matters when you're generating five or ten variants to test, not one.
- A flagship cut once a winning hook is found — Kling 3.0's native 4K output gives the sharpest final version, at a higher price and stricter content review than the faster options.
- A version with voiceover or sound design — Veo 3.1 generates native audio with every clip. Seedance 2.0 Fast also supports audio, toggleable off per request if you'd rather add sound separately.

Writing an Ad-Ready i2v Prompt
The same [PRESERVE] + [MOTION] structure that works for general photo-to-video needs one addition for ads: the [PRESERVE] block should describe the product with enough specificity that it survives being regenerated four or five times.
[PRESERVE] Keep the bottle's exact label design, cap color, andglass shape identical to the reference photo in every variant.[MOTION] Fast 0.5-second light sweep across the label, then aquarter turn revealing the side panel, 3-second total clip.
Naming the hook motion precisely — and repeating the same [PRESERVE] block unchanged across every variant prompt — is what keeps a batch of test clips actually comparable to each other.
